Product Overview

Category:

The 1.5SMC8.2AHE3/9AT belongs to the category of TVS (Transient Voltage Suppressor) diodes.

Use:

It is used for surge protection in electronic circuits, providing a high level of protection against transient voltage events.

Characteristics:

  • Fast response time
  • Low clamping voltage
  • High surge current capability
  • RoHS compliant

Package:

The 1.5SMC8.2AHE3/9AT is available in a DO-214AB (SMC) package.

Essence:

This TVS diode serves as a critical component in safeguarding sensitive electronic devices from voltage surges and spikes.

Packaging/Quantity:

The 1.5SMC8.2AHE3/9AT is typically packaged in reels with a quantity of 1500 units per reel.

Working Principles

The 1.5SMC8.2AHE3/9AT operates by diverting excessive transient currents away from sensitive components, thereby limiting the voltage across the protected circuit.
